    long time since I last posted some of my razors here, mainly because I was so busy making all these razors

    Here we go with the first one:






    8/8 damascus razor ("DSC" superclean damascus from Balbach germany in twisted pattern) with a special grind with a prominent belly, which looks and sounds like a fullhollow but is stiff like a wedge grind.
    The scales are made of Juma with a wedge made of brass and Bullseye rivets. The pins itself are sterling silver.

    Number two:






    This one is also a 8/8" damascus razor made of the same Steel, but with a coarser serration on the tang and a 1/2 hollow grind. The scales are made of lightning strike Carbon with bullseye rivets and a wedge made of the same damascus as the blade.

    Number 3:




    8/8" 1/4 hollow ground blade with DLC coating. The scales are made of ligthning strike Carbon. The turned spacer and the bullseyes are made of Nickelsilver. This razor has the name "Stealth razor"

    Here is another razor I recently made for a customer:

    8/8" full hollow, spanisch point, spine with mirrorpolished spinework, satinfinish on the hollow ground, polished "as forged look" on the tang. The scales are made of juma gem in violet (not everyones taste ;-) but the customer wanted it and I have to admit that I was surprised how nice it turned out when finished)
